SDN-driven effective defragmentation technique on Multi Core Fiber is demonstrated. High speed integrated dual output intensity modulator switch is utilized for core adaptation in combination with hitless frequency shift, showing quasi hitless reconfiguration performance.
A flexible optical carrier source for bandwidth variable transponders (BV-Ts) managing a variable number of carriers at continuously variable free spectral range (FSR) up to 100 GHz is experimentally demonstrated. We propose an SBVT based on programmable multi-wavelength source with asymmetric channel spacing. SBVT, controlled by extended SDN, supporting 480 Gb/s super-channel and up to three sliceable optical flows is demonstrated in a network testbed.
